Capitol Reef National Park : Capitol Reef National Park is dominated by the Waterpocket Fold. For 100 miles its parallel ridges rise from the desert like the swell of giant waves rolling toward shore. It's exposed edges have erodet into slickrock wilderness of massive domes, cliffs,and a maze of twisting canyons.

Zion National Park : A million years of flowing water has cut through the red and white beds of Navajo Sandstone that forms the sheer walls of Zion. The Virgin River carved it's way through a gorge so deep and narrow that sunlight seldom penetrates to the bottom.

Grand Canyon in Arizona : Some of the oldest exposed rock in the world, dating back 1.8 billion years, lies at the bottom of this gorge. It is one mile deep and up to 18 miles wide, but only covers 277 miles of the Colorado River.
